摘要 <p><P>PROBLEM TO BE SOLVED: To provide a surface-coated member of a cutting tool or the like having high adhesiveness and wear resistance. <P>SOLUTION: The cutting tool includes: a lower layer 7 composed of one or more layers each made of titanium carbide, titanium nitrride, titanium carbonitride, titanium oxycarbide, titanium oxynitride or titanium oxycarbonitride; and an Al<SB POS="POST">2</SB>O<SB POS="POST">3</SB>layer 8 of anα-type crystal structure. The layers 7 and 8 are formed on the surface of a substrate 5 of the cutting tool. In the surface-coated member of the cutting tool 1 or the like, in a Raman spectrum obtained by irradiating the surface of the Al<SB POS="POST">2</SB>O<SB POS="POST">3</SB>layer 8 with He-Ne laser having a wavelength of 514.53 nm, with respect to a peak intensity I<SB POS="POST">O</SB>of a broad peak adjacent on the lower wave number side from the peak of the Al<SB POS="POST">2</SB>O<SB POS="POST">3</SB>layer of a wave number 416-420 cm<SP POS="POST">-1</SP>, when the peak intensity of a peak appearing in a range of a wave number 1,050-1,120 cm<SP POS="POST">-1</SP>is defined as I<SB POS="POST">1</SB>, and when the peak intensity of a peak appearing in a range of wave number 780-850 cm<SP POS="POST">-1</SP>is defined as I<SB POS="POST">2</SB>, a ratio (I<SB POS="POST">1</SB>/I<SB POS="POST">0</SB>) is 0.05-0.5 and a ratio (I<SB POS="POST">2</SB>/I<SB POS="POST">0</SB>) is also 0.05-0.5. <P>COPYRIGHT: (C)2012,JPO&INPIT</p>
